c 方法重载:怎样把两个表(有相同的字段)怎样合并成一个表?(Excel)
来源:百度文库 编辑:偶看新闻 时间:2024/05/10 07:21:47
怎样把两个表(有相同的字段)怎样合并成一个表?(Excel)
[日期:2008-07-13] 来源: 作者: [字体:大 中 小] 思路:用CountIf()函数对表1进行判断,如果其值为0,则表示没以重复,再将表2中和表1不重复的数据复制到表1中,从而实现两表合一。
解题的方法:
Sub dd()
b = Sheets(2).[a1].CurrentRegion.Rows.Count + 1
‘判断表2的行数
For i = 3 To b
a = Sheets(1).[a1].CurrentRegion.Rows.Count + 1
‘判断表1的行数
c = Sheets(2).[a1].CurrentRegion.Columns.Count
‘判断表2的列数
If Application.WorksheetFunction.CountIf(Sheets(1).[b1:b1000], Sheets(2).Cells(i, 2)) = 0 Then
Sheets(2).Range(Sheets(2).Cells(i, 1), Sheets(2).Cells(i, c)).Copy Sheets(1).Cells(a, 1)
‘将表2中与表1不重复的数据复制到表1中
End If
Next
End Sub
阅读:440 次
录入:admin
【 评论 】 【 推荐 】 【 打印 】 上一篇:删除字符串中某个字符的函数是什么?删除字符串中某个字符的函数是什么?(Excel)
下一篇:如何用vba实现删除最右边的字符(Excel)
VF6.0中如何把字段相同的两个表中的数据合并成一个新表?
如何合并两个表格,使相同的字段不重复,两个表格有相同的主键
两张excel工作表中行数不一样多,但其中有一字段是相同的,我想把它们合并,如何操作比较简单快速
SQL中两表其中一字段相同,怎样显示指定的相同字段?
怎样把两个吧合并?
在一个表中怎样把某一字段中值相同的条目提取出来?
怎样把Excel工作表中相同的单元格合并或留一个其他的删除
VFP中使用什么命令可以把两个字符字段的数据合并成一个?
vf问题:怎样把一个表中的部分数据添加到另一个表中?(两表的学号字段相同)
怎样把两个音乐文件合并成一个文件
怎样把两个磁盘合并成一个磁盘?
怎样把现在的e和f两个分区合并成一个区?
桌面有现两个相同的程序,怎样把其中一个删除
怎样合并两个磁盘分区?
怎样将excel的两个表格合并成一个
asp中用sql语句联合查询多个表,如果两个表中有相同字段,查询结果会怎样?
怎样合并两个域名的流量
两个不同数据库的相同表数据合并 ,怎么样操作?
两个不同数据库的相同表数据合并 ,怎么样操作?
ACCESS两个字段如何合并
怎样可以把两个内容一样却名称不一样的帖吧合并?
有什么软件可以把视频文件合并成一个视频文件,哪里能下载 (相同格式的)
怎样合并两个主分区
急问,怎样将几条相同记录合并